I know in the old days of DTV you could combine dtv and OTA antenna through a sat. diplexor.I tried this with my new home setup with comcast cable and i could not get sat 99 at all.No signal.I remove the 2 diplxerors and conect direct and get signal at 99%
It was only 99 that would not come in .101 and all others were perfect?
Any ideas on hold to get this to work as the home was pre-wired.
Thanks for any help.
 
Actually there is a way,as long as you install the b-band converter before you diplex the satellite signal .

Actually attach the b-band converter to the
Diplexer that you are running from the dish
On the sat in port.
 
If you have an H/HR 23 or higher this will not work since the b-band in built into the ird.
